Magnesium/Calcium ratios of Globigerinoides ruber (white) s.s. of core NAP63-1

DOI

Here we present planktonic foraminifera Globigerinoides ruber (white) s.s. Mg/Ca ratios (mmol/mol) obtained in marine sediment core NAP63-1 (24.8384°S, 44.3187°W, 842 m water depth, 224 cm sediment recovery) retrieved with the aid of a piston corer from the SW Atlantic upper slope. For Mg/Ca analyses, between 30-50 shells of G. ruber (white) s.s. tests were picked from the 250–300 µm size fraction and analyzed with a Thermo Scientific iCap Q quadrupole ICP-MS. Mg/Ca ratios were applied to obtain SW Atlantic sea-surface temperature estimates over the last 50 kyr. Our results highlight the relationship between the SW Atlantic sea-surface conditions and Atlantic Meridional Overturning Circulation strength.
